How your farmhouse stove installation enquiry unfolds
- 01
Phone or email enquiry — we'll talk through what you're hoping to achieve and arrange a free survey
- 02
Free on-site survey at your Coaltown of Balgonie property — chimney check, room measurements, ventilation assessment
- 03
Detailed written quote covering stove, flue work, hearth, fitting and certification
- 04
Booked installation date, usually within a few weeks depending on stock
- 05
Installation completed in one to two days with full site protection and tidy-up
- 06
Commissioning, walk-through of safe operation and HETAS certificate emailed within 14 days
